Where to Use with Caution

  1. Small Hoop Sizes: The more detailed designs might not fit well within tight hoop spaces. If you're working on something like a cap or hat embroidery, simplify the design or use only a portion of it.
  2. Textured Fabrics: Designs with fine details or tiny lettering may get lost on flannel, denim, or other rougher materials. Stick to smoother surfaces for best results.
  3. Thin or Stretchy Fabrics: Without proper stabilizer, these designs could pucker or distort. Always test stitch density and choose the right backing material.
  4. Dark Fabric Backgrounds: Thread color contrast is key. On black or navy backgrounds, white or light-colored threads will help the design pop, but you’ll need to double-check visibility during setup.
  5. Curved Surfaces: When placing the design on curved areas like a cap or sleeve, consider scaling and positioning adjustments to maintain clarity and proportion after stitching.
  6. Dense Stitch Areas: If your machine struggles with high stitch density, avoid using multiple layers or overlapping elements unless you’re confident in your equipment's capabilities.

Testing Is Key

Before committing to a large batch of custom apparel or selling finished products, I always recommend testing Mom to the Power of SVG on scrap fabric. This lets you see how the design interacts with your chosen thread colors, fabric texture, and machine settings. You can also experiment with different layouts—maybe a horizontal placement on a hoodie versus a vertical one on a pillow cover—to find what looks best.
